The Early Days: From Arcade Cabinets to Home Consoles

The Birth of Gaming

Gaming began in the arcades of the 1970s, where players would flock to play simple yet addictive games like Pong and Space Invaders. These arcade cabinets introduced the world to interactive entertainment and laid the foundation for what gaming would become.

The Rise of Home Consoles

With the introduction of home consoles like the Atari 2600 and Nintendo Entertainment System (NES), gaming became accessible to a wider audience. Players could enjoy their favourite games from the comfort of their living rooms, sparking a new era of gaming that focused on immersive experiences and storytelling.

The Technological Revolution: Graphics, Sound, and Connectivity

Advancements in Graphics and Sound

As technology progressed, so did the visuals and audio in gaming. From the 16-bit era of the Super Nintendo to the cutting-edge graphics of modern consoles and gaming PCs, games have become visually stunning and incredibly realistic. Similarly, advancements in sound technology have enhanced the immersive experience, with games featuring orchestral scores and detailed sound effects.

Online Connectivity and Multiplayer Gaming

The advent of the internet has revolutionised gaming by introducing online connectivity and multiplayer experiences. Players can now connect with others around the world, team up, or compete in massive multiplayer online games (MMOs). This online connectivity has transformed gaming into a social experience, fostering communities and friendships across geographical boundaries.

The Rise of Mobile Gaming

Gaming on the Go

The rise of smartphones and tablets has brought gaming into the hands of millions. Mobile gaming has surged in popularity, with casual and immersive games readily available on app stores. Players can enjoy gaming on the go, whether it’s during their daily commute or while waiting for an appointment. The accessibility and convenience of mobile gaming have opened up new opportunities and expanded the gaming audience.

Casual and Social Gaming

Mobile gaming has also popularised casual and social gaming experiences. Games like Candy Crush Saga and Words with Friends have captivated players of all ages, offering quick and addictive gameplay. Social gaming has allowed friends and family to connect and play together, even when they’re physically apart, further blurring the lines between gaming and social interaction.

The Future of Gaming: Virtual Reality, Augmented Reality, and Beyond

Virtual Reality (VR) and Immersive Experiences

Virtual Reality (VR) technology has made significant strides in recent years, offering players immersive experiences like never before. With VR headsets, players can step into virtual worlds and interact with their surroundings, creating a new level of immersion and realism. From gaming to virtual tourism and education, VR has the potential to transform various industries and redefine entertainment experiences.

Augmented Reality (AR) and Real-World Integration

Augmented Reality (AR) has gained attention with the release of games like Pokémon Go. By overlaying digital content onto the real world, AR gaming blends virtual elements with the player’s physical environment. This technology has the potential to revolutionise gaming by creating interactive and dynamic experiences that seamlessly integrate the virtual and real worlds.
